NZ's ANZ makes a strong profit despite parent's flat result
12:17 PM.The country's largest bank, ANZ, has posted a record full year result of nealy $2 billion on the back of a solid local economy. Audio

Tilt says above average wind conditions delivers strong result
12:21 PM.The wind energy company, Tilt Renewables, says above average wind conditions helped it deliver a strong first half result, despite a drop in net profit. Audio

Building consents fall
12:22 PM.The number of building consents issued has fallen 1.5 percent in September on the month before. Audio
